Best Mountain View Public Middle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 381 students in Mountain View, AR.
The top ranked public middle school in Mountain View, AR is Mountain View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Mountain View, AR public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 36% (versus the Arkansas public middle school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 48% (versus the 42% statewide average). Middle schools in Mountain View have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Arkansas public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 6%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is less than the Arkansas public middle school average of 41% (majority Black).
